Bishop’s Stortford College Prep School is a welcoming and purposeful community in which pupils are encouraged to develop confidence, curiosity, independence and consideration for others.

Relationships between pupils and staff are central to the positive atmosphere of the school and to our commitment to building confidence for life.

The GAP Assistant will contribute actively to the academic, pastoral and co-curricular life of the Prep School.

The role offers broad experience of working with pupils and colleagues in a busy independent school environment.

This role would be particularly suited to a candidate who is looking to pursue a career in teaching or educational psychology.
